About The Role
Portering Services provides essential support to all areas of the hospital. The porter will be expected to react to the various challenges within the working environment, and the workload may be increased due to external influences including the environment, weather, patient capacity etc.

The porter will work as part of a team contributing to the smooth running of the service, providing an efficient and effective response to requests for patient movement, assistance in emergency situations, collection and delivery of samples and medicines etc, whilst ensuring that other tasks such as delivery of meal trolleys, linen, goods and mail etc are carried out in a timely manner.

Whilst many of the tasks are generally routine the daily functioning of the service may be unpredictable therefore a flexible approach is essential, and the post holder will be expected to use own initiative.

Key tasks & responsibilities:

  • To transfer patients in a safe and appropriate manner to and from the wards, theatres and departments via means of walking, wheelchair, stretcher, bed.
  • Conveyance of patient notes and x-rays to and from wards/departments, as requested.
  • To replace medical gasses where necessary.
  • Remove equipment from wards/departments as required.
  • Removal of clinical and nonclinical waste and laundry from all areas as required.
  • To accept linen deliveries, check and store correctly in designated areas. Prepare linen trolleys for delivery to all areas as per agreed stock levels.
  • Ensure correct records are maintained. Assist in transporting trolleys to and from wards and departments. Offload in the correct area with the correct amounts of linen.
  • Assist in the transporting of catering trolleys to and from wards.
  • Change curtains on wards and departments as requested by the Domestic Support Manager or Supervisors.
  • Attend team meetings as required and suggest improvements to working practices.
  • Cleaning duties as required.
  • Any other reasonably requested duties by the Domestic Services Manager.
